Technical Details of LG-Ericsson ECS3510-26P

  • Model: LG-Ericsson ECS3510-26P / L2 Fast Ethernet Switch with PoE
  • Ports: 24 x 10/100 Mbps PoE ports; 2 x combo Gigabit RJ-45/SFP uplink ports
  • Layer/Features: Layer 2/4 switching with VLAN support, QoS, and basic security features for small to mid-size deployments
  • Power: PoE-capable on 24 ports; power budget and availability depend on power supply configuration
  • Performance: Fast Ethernet switching optimized for desktop and wiring closet use; supports efficient traffic management and edge connectivity
  • Management: Web-based GUI and standard management practices for easy setup, monitoring, and maintenance
  • Mounting: Desktop or rack-mountable design suitable for multiple installation scenarios
  • Security: Basic port-based access control and VLAN segmentation to help protect sensitive devices and data

How to install LG-Ericsson ECS3510-26P

Installing the ECS3510-26P is designed to be intuitive, with a straightforward sequence that gets you up and running quickly while laying the groundwork for scalable growth. Begin by selecting a stable, well-ventilated location—either a dedicated rack in a wiring closet or a secure desktop placement where cabling can be managed neatly. Ensure the power supply is accessible and that there is adequate clearance around the device for cooling to maintain stable operation over long periods. Once the hardware is positioned, follow these steps to complete the initial setup and begin using the switch effectively:

  • Unpack and inspect: Remove the ECS3510-26P from its packaging, verify that all components are present, and check for any signs of damage from shipping. Confirm that the power cord is included or that a compatible power supply is available for PoE operation. This initial check helps prevent later installation delays and ensures your device is ready for fast deployment.

  • Connect power and basic cabling: Plug the switch into a reliable power source and verify that the power indicator lights illuminate. Begin by connecting your uplink devices, such as a core switch or router, to the two combo Gigabit ports using appropriate Cat5e/Cat6 cables. This establishes the path to your network backbone and provides the necessary bandwidth for downstream devices connected to the PoE ports.

  • Populate PoE devices: Attach PoE-enabled devices—such as cameras, phones, or wireless access points—to the 24 PoE-capable ports. As devices are connected, observe the PoE indicators to confirm that power is being delivered and data is flowing correctly. Ensure you are within the switch's power budget limitations to avoid overloading the uplink or power source.

  • Access the management interface: Use a web browser to access the switch’s management interface. You may need to assign a static IP address to your computer within the same subnet as the switch or enable DHCP if supported by your network. Log in using the default credentials provided by the manufacturer, then proceed to configure basic settings such as the management IP, admin password, and initial VLANs.

  • Configure VLANs and QoS: Create VLANs to segment traffic for security and performance. Assign ports to the appropriate VLANs and configure QoS rules to prioritize latency-sensitive traffic, like voice and video. This step helps ensure stable performance for critical applications while maintaining network organization for easier administration.

  • Enable PoE management and monitor health: If the switch supports PoE management, enable PoE controls to monitor and allocate power to connected devices. Regularly review port status, PoE usage, and link health through the web interface. Scheduling periodic firmware updates and reviewing security settings will keep the device protected and reliable over time.

  • Document your configuration: Save the configuration to persistent memory and export a backup if the interface allows. Keep a record of VLAN configurations, port assignments, and any custom QoS rules. Documentation makes future upgrades, troubleshooting, and scale-out deployments faster and less error-prone.
